Web14 mrt. 2024 · Summary. Molluscum contagiosum is a common infection in children and young adults and is usually acquired through direct skin-to-skin contact. Diagnosis is clinical in the majority of cases. Lesions appear as umbilicated, pearl-like, smooth papules. At least one third of patients will develop symptoms of local erythema, swelling, or pruritus. WebMolluscum contagiosum is more common in individuals with atopic dermatitis, and its lesions tend to be more persistent, more extensive and more generalised in atopic children.
